Output dd31c487614f12b1e02009d50b9019a881bf04af942a0ae1e9e1e8f741239937:1

value
610314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25dcb699e0ff568c76ba3b1e1b9b87d930902b3a OP_EQUAL
address
359DL4yjHTAu8xqT5mp1YfoEiWgYcPWUAv
transaction
dd31c487614f12b1e02009d50b9019a881bf04af942a0ae1e9e1e8f741239937
spent
true